ASBESTOS UPDATE: Union Carbide Has 66,099 Open Claims at June 30

Union Carbide Corporation faced 66,099 unresolved asbestos claims at June 30, 2010, compared with 74,957 unresolved claims at June 30, 2009, according to the Company’s quarterly report filed on Aug. 4, 2010 with the Securities and Exchange Commission.

ASBESTOS UPDATE: Union Carbide Still Has $84M June 30 Receivable

Union Carbide Corporation’s receivable for insurance recoveries related to its asbestos liability was US$84 million at June 30, 2010 and Dec. 31, 2009, according to the Company’s quarterly report filed on Aug. 4, 2010 with the Securities and Exchange Commission.
